我对编码非常陌生,我正在读一本关于它的书。而且我认为我已经掌握了这个我正在做的小测试项目的基础知识,但每当我测试页面时,我只看到我使用的代码。这是我的全部代码。
<script type = "text/javascript">;
//<![CDATA[
// from concat.html
var person = "" ;
person = prompt( "What is your name?") ;
alert("Hi there, ") + person + "!");
//]]>
</script>
老实说,我不知道CDATA是什么或者什么是concat.html。
如何让Firefox运行我的JavaScript,而不仅仅是显示代码?
答案 0 :(得分:0)
尝试将其包装在<html>
中,以使整个页面被视为HTML。该文件是否具有.js扩展名?
CDATA用于区分代码和标记。
答案 1 :(得分:0)
将其放入HTML文件中。
首先,将其保存为scriptname.html - 您将JavaScript嵌入HTML文件中。
接下来,将其设为有效的html - 将<html>
添加到顶部,将</html>
添加到底部。在适当的情况下<head>
和<body>
标记 - 如果您不知道它们是什么,请访问任何HTML网站查找它们(www.diveintohtml5.org很好,如果您可以关注它。)
答案 2 :(得分:0)
最好为Firefox安装Firebug插件或使用其他浏览器的Javascript控制台。它将允许您运行您的代码 http://www.w3resource.com/web-development-tools/execute-JavaScript-on-the-fly-with-Firebug.php